Show Notes
Amanda Medford, a second-generation homeschooler, explains how events like Women's Encouragement Day can help homeschoolers build community. Amanda has homeschooled five children in three states and knows the importance of fellowship and connection along your educational journey!
-Why Amanda decided to join the Encouragement Day committee [2:00]
-The differences between her homeschool journey vs. her children's [3:10]
-Tips Amanda learned along the way to help with homeschooling [5:20]
-What if you're beginning homeschool in the middle of the school year? [8:30]
-Some of the changes planned to Women's Encouragement Day this year, compared to previous years [11:00]
